    Notes 
    • never married, lived in Morocco, Newton County, Indiana. He was a private in World War I serving in the Indiana 15th Fld Artillery. He is buried in the cemetery just north of Morocco, Indiana.

      ARTHUR L. BASSETT (Feb. 5, 1964)

      Arthur L. Bassett, 76, a retired carpenter, died Wednesday at the Veterans Hospital, Indianapolis. He had been a patient there since late December. He had been living in Rensselaer when he fell and fractured his hip.
      He was born in Morocco and was a veteran of World War I. He never married. Surviving are a sister, Mrs. Charles Hoover of Mt. Ayr and a brother Elmer of Oklahoma City, Oklahoma.
      Funeral services were conducted Friday at 2 o'clock at Hancock's Funeral Home with Rev. Donald Crellin officiating. Interment was in the Oakland Cemetery.
